What is the normal working voltage of screw air compressor?

The normal working rated voltage of screw air compressor is 380V, which can fluctuate up and down around 5%. This refers to the voltage during normal operation. The transformer is relatively small. When the device is not turned on, the voltage is 400V, but when the device is turned on, the voltage drops to 350V.

What is a rotary screw air compressor?

A rotary screw air compressor is one of the two types of positive displacement gas compressors. It uses two rotors to create the pressure needed for air compression. They are one of the easiest types of air compressors to use and maintain. The other type of positive displacement compressor is the reciprocating or piston compressor.

How does a screw compressor work?

A screw compressor can run loaded ('pumping air') or unloaded ('idle'). The inlet/loading valve opens and closes according to air demand. The inlet valve is controlled by a solenoid valve that supplies control air to the inlet/loading valve. Check solenoid valve coil and solenoid valve operation.

What happens if the pressure of the screw air compressor unit exceeds?

The pressure of the screw air compressor unit exceeds the rated pressure. For example, if the actual pressure reaches 0.85MPa, the machine with 0.8MPa is prone to overload. What is a compressor assembly?

The compressor assembly is a positive displacement, oil ood lubricated, helical rotary screw type unit employing a single stage of compression. The components include housing or stator, two rotors or screws, bearings and bearing supports. In operation two helical grooved rotors mesh to compress air.
